n. a system of principles for philosophic or scientific investigations; an instrument for acquiring knowledge [also: organa (pl)]

The Organon (Greek: Ὄργανον, meaning "instrument, tool, organ") is the standard collection of Aristotle 's six works on logic . The name Organon was given by Aristotle's followers, the Peripatetics . They are as follows:

Organon \Or"ga*non\, Organum \Or"ga*num\, n. [NL. organon, L. organum. See Organ .] An organ or instrument; hence, a method by which philosophical or scientific investigation may be conducted; -- a term adopted from the Aristotelian writers by Lord Bacon, ...
